Output e313ff304e7089f9e6451615c181e50b9a7bf667793d10f6c7a61effa62f1a75:9

value
59139631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376f86ed3993341ab0fa0574c8deff7bfdad9 OP_EQUAL
address
3BMEXuqejNNaZaddmtAwYjA5S45jeMmYa2
transaction
e313ff304e7089f9e6451615c181e50b9a7bf667793d10f6c7a61effa62f1a75
spent
true